An estimate of 86.73 percent of the residents in 32754 has some form of health insurance. 44.11 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 58.06 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 32754 would have to travel an average of 8.96 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Parrish Medical Center. In a 20-mile radius, there are 1,842 healthcare providers accessible to residents living in 32754, Mims, Florida.
